Summary

The article explains how to connect AI models to the MicroM8 Apple IIe emulator using the Model Context Protocol (MCP), enabling advanced interactions like "vibe coding" and integration with Turtlespaces Logo. This approach demonstrates new possibilities for enhancing retro computing environments with AI, potentially inspiring innovative educational and creative applications in the AI field.
